Specific function: Involved in chromosome condensation, segregation and cell cycle progression. May participate in facilitating chromosome segregation by condensation DNA from both sides of a centrally located replisome during cell division. Not required for mini-F plasmid

COG id: COG3006

COG function: function code D; Uncharacterized protein involved in chromosome partitioning

Gene ontology:

Cell location: Cytoplasm, nucleoid. Note=Restricted to the nucleoid region (By similarity)
